Abstract

The invention discloses a novel branch line balun. The novel branch line balun comprises a balance end 1, an unbalance end 2, an isolation end 3 and a transmission line 5, and the balance end 1 is electrically connected with the unbalance end 2 through the transmission line 5, an impedance matching unit is arranged on the balance end 1, and a load resistor 31 is arranged on the isolation end 3. According to the invention, the impedance matching unit is arranged at the balance end 1 to carry out standing wave matching, so that signals of the first balance end 11 and the second balance end 12 are ensured to have a relatively stable phase difference in a large input frequency range, the circuit is ensured to have stable insertion loss in a large input frequency range, and the problem that thepassband bandwidth of a traditional planar branch line balun is small is solved. The load resistor 31 is arranged on the isolation end 3, so that the even-mode impedance of the balun in an even-modestate is improved, and the problem that the isolation degree of the balance end of the balun of the traditional planar branch line is relatively poor is solved.

technical field [0001] The invention relates to the communication field, in particular to a novel branch line balun. Background technique [0002] Balun is a converter of balanced and unbalanced signals, and also has the function of impedance transformation. Specifically, the balun is a three-port network, broadly speaking, it consists of three parts: an unbalanced port, a pair of balanced ports and an isolated end. The working characteristic of the balun is to output equal-amplitude and anti-phase signals from two balanced ports. This characteristic makes it have good phase balance, amplitude balance and power equalization. Typical balun structures include branch line baluns, Marchand baluns, and Wilkinson power divider baluns. [0003] At present, the planar branch line balun is limited by the PCB processing technology, and there are problems of small passband bandwidth and poor isolation.
